Output c21acfef847e6b5635dba5a5fa704e9c5a23db86ac6a0d3bda1ec6a965fd950a:27

value
63649506
script pubkey
OP_0 OP_PUSHBYTES_20 57ce19e85f208e715d7a6f576a8005b569e6dc9e
address
bc1q2l8pn6zlyz88zht6datk4qq9k457dhy77gh5l3
transaction
c21acfef847e6b5635dba5a5fa704e9c5a23db86ac6a0d3bda1ec6a965fd950a
spent
false